Orpheus antiquissimus & optimus poëta, philosophus trismegistus de lapidibus, nunc demum latio iure donatus. M. Hannardo Gamerio poeta laureato interprete. Accesserunt ejusdem Hannardi scholia, quæ & rei medicæ studiosis utilia jucundaque ; futura sunt : & quæ quibusdam locis obscurioribus plurimum lucis adferent. Accessit prætereà argumentum in Orphei libellum Renato Perdrierio interprete
